‘Sitting at a laptop creates an image that I carry back.’ (Jay Cool)
A neck with a thousand folds.
A bump harboured by an anxious nose.
A line, puckered into peaks and troughs, of 48 years near gone.
A thought.
It is not me.
Just an image.
An image of another me in another time.
Not me now.
Now, I write myself into being –
smoothing out the lines and carrying them
over and
back.
